温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Hadoop数据库如何保障数据不受硬件故障影响

发布时间:2024-12-22 14:46:13 来源:亿速云 阅读:81 作者:小樊 栏目:大数据

Hadoop数据库,实际上是一个分布式文件系统HDFS(Hadoop Distributed File System),它通过一系列策略和技术来保障数据不受硬件故障的影响。以下是Hadoop如何实现数据冗余和故障恢复的详细分析:

Hadoop的数据冗余策略

  • 数据块复制:HDFS默认将数据分成固定大小的数据块,并在集群中的不同节点上存储这些数据块的多个副本。这种分布式存储方式确保了即使某个节点发生故障,数据仍然可以从其他节点上的副本中恢复,从而防止数据丢失。
  • 数据备份:除了数据块复制,Hadoop还支持数据备份功能,可以通过配置备份节点或使用相关工具来备份数据。这为数据提供了额外的保护层。

故障恢复机制

  • NameNode元数据备份与恢复:在发生故障时,可以通过备份的元数据快速恢复NameNode,确保集群能够正常运行。
  • 数据恢复方法:包括回收站机制恢复、快照机制恢复、编辑日志恢复以及数据备份恢复。这些方法提供了多层次的数据保护,确保在遇到各种故障情况时能够有效地恢复数据。

数据安全性

  • 数据加密与访问控制:虽然上述信息没有直接提及数据加密和访问控制,但这是Hadoop生态系统中保障数据安全的重要方面。通过加密数据传输和存储,以及实施严格的访问控制策略,可以进一步保护数据不受未授权访问和篡改。

通过上述策略和方法,Hadoop能够有效地保障数据不受硬件故障的影响,确保数据的高可用性和安全性。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I